City of Quincy Aeronautics Committee met April 2.

Here is the agenda provided by the committee:

Call To Order

Public Comments (3-minute limit per speaker):

Approval of the March Aeronautics Committee meeting minutes

Mayor’s Report

Old Business

• Proposal From Lucky Trish regarding the replacement of underground fuel tanks. Table for another month.

Engineering Report

Airport Director’s Report

New Business

• Request approval for Quincy Airport to enter into a T Hangar lease agreement (C6) with Joe Garceau from Aurora Illinois. Per current city ordinance not required.

• Request approval for Quincy Airport to enter into a T Hangar lease agreement (C3) with a new T Hangar tennant. Per city ordinance not required.

• Request approval for Quincy Airport to enter into a contract with Crawford Murphy and Tilly for $102,000. This agreement is to conduct a terminal feasibility study. The agreement will be funded 95% by the federal government, 2.5% by the state and 2.5% by the city.

• Request approval to have four GPS trackers removed from airport vehicles, tractor 6A, tractor 7A, Oshkosh plow 3A & Oshkosh Blower/Broom 8A

• Request approval for the City of Quincy Mayor, to enter into a grant agreement with the FAA for the purchase of two snow removal vehicles. The city’s estimated cost would be $58,625.

• Decide whether the city should seek liquidated damages for construction project UIN 5025 involving amount of working days over runs. The project was bid for 109 days, and we are expecting it to end up at 155 days.
